Provider Score in 02130, Jamaica Plain, Massachusetts

The Provider Score for the Breast Cancer Score in 02130, Jamaica Plain, Massachusetts is 99 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 96.96 percent of the residents in 02130 has some form of health insurance. 29.79 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 74.56 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ase. For the 6,854 residents under the age of 18, there is an estimate of 65 pediatricians in a 20-mile radius of 02130. An estimate of 29 geriatricians or physicians who focus on the elderly who can serve the 4,889 residents over the age of 65 years.

In a 20-mile radius, there are 11,768 health care providers accessible to residents in 02130, Jamaica Plain, Massachusetts.

Physician-to-patient ratios in Jamaica Plain, while generally favorable compared to national averages, require closer examination within the specific context of breast cancer care. The density of primary care physicians (PCPs) is a significant factor, as they often serve as the initial point of contact for patients, initiating screenings and referrals. A higher PCP density generally translates to better access. However, the availability of specialists, particularly oncologists and breast surgeons, is even more critical. Analyzing the ratio of these specialists to the population is essential. This analysis needs to consider the geographic distribution of specialists within the ZIP code and the surrounding areas, as travel distance can significantly impact patient access, especially for those with mobility limitations or transportation challenges.

Standout practices in Jamaica Plain demonstrate a commitment to comprehensive breast cancer care. These practices often integrate a multidisciplinary approach, bringing together surgeons, oncologists, radiologists, and support staff to provide coordinated care. They are likely to participate in clinical trials, offering patients access to cutting-edge treatments and research opportunities. Furthermore, these practices typically emphasize patient education and support, providing resources to help patients understand their diagnosis, treatment options, and potential side effects. They may offer support groups, counseling services, and access to financial assistance programs.

Telemedicine adoption has become increasingly important, particularly in the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ic. Practices that have embraced telemedicine offer patients greater flexibility and convenience, reducing the need for frequent in-person visits, especially for routine follow-ups and consultations. Telemedicine can be particularly beneficial for patients with mobility issues, those living in remote areas, or those who find it difficult to travel due to other commitments. The quality of telemedicine services varies; therefore, the analysis needs to assess the types of services offered (e.g., virtual consultations, remote monitoring), the technological infrastructure in place (e.g., secure video platforms, patient portals), and the level of training and support provided to both patients and providers.

Mental health resources are an often-overlooked but critical aspect of breast cancer care. A diagnosis of breast cancer can be emotionally devastating, leading to anxiety, depression, and other mental health challenges. Practices that recognize this and provide access to mental health services are better equipped to support their patients' overall well-being. These resources may include on-site therapists, referrals to mental health professionals, support groups, and educational materials. The analysis will assess the availability of these resources within the practices and the broader community, including the accessibility of these services for patients with varying insurance coverage and financial constraints.

The assessment of mental health resources needs to consider the integration of mental health services into the overall care plan. Practices that proactively screen patients for mental health issues, offer integrated counseling services, and coordinate care with mental health professionals demonstrate a commitment to holistic patient care. This integration can significantly improve patient outcomes and quality of life.

The analysis also needs to consider the diversity of the patient population in Jamaica Plain. Breast cancer disproportionately affects certain racial and ethnic groups, and disparities in access to care and treatment outcomes exist. Practices that are culturally sensitive and provide care that is tailored to the needs of diverse populations are essential. This includes offering language services, culturally competent healthcare providers, and educational materials in multiple languages.
